Abstract
This paper highlights the problems faced by women in 20th century by citing the examples from the novels of Mulk Raj Anand. The gender bigotry in the patriarchal society of colonial India, in particular, is deftly portrayed by Anand through his characters. The atrocities of the male characters like Reggie and the suffering of female characters like Sohini,Gauri,Rukmini allow the readers to get a realistic perception of the days of colonial era, particularly in the lower strata of society working in the tea plantation that were governed ruthlessly by the colonial representatives. The novels of Anand are a record of the social conditioning of the working class women and men of those days.
